一般描述

24:1 (Cis) PC (1,2-dinervonoyl-sn-glycero-3-phosphocholine) has two 24 carbon fatty acid chains, each having one cis double bond at the 15th carbon.
The list of Phosphatidylcholine products offered by Avanti is designed to provide compounds having a variety of physical properties. Products available include short chain (C3-C8 are water soluble and hygroscopic), saturated, multi-unsaturated and mixed acid PC′s. All of the products are purified by HPLC, and special precautions are taken to protect the products for oxidization and hydrolysis.

应用

24:1 (Cis) PC (1,2-dinervonoyl-sn-glycero-3-phosphocholine) may be used in planar bilayer lipid membranes (BLMs) to study the effect of lipid chain length on single-channel properties of C-terminal colicin peptide (P178). It may also be used in planar bilayers to explore the single channel activities of BKCa (hSlo α-subunit) channels.

生化/生理作用

Phosphatidylcholine (PC) may participate in the signaling of neuronal differentiation.
